  3. <blockquote data-ipsquote="" class="ipsQuote" data-ipsquote-username="theflame8" data-cite="theflame8" data-ipsquote-contentapp="forums" data-ipsquote-contenttype="forums" data-ipsquote-contentid="44604" data-ipsquote-contentclass="forums_Topic"><div>Compared to TEW, does broadcasters work differently? It seems like you can continue to gain popularity at med and high international with a tiny tv provider. Is that right, because it's confusing to me?<p> </p><p> 2nd question: If you don't run shows or have tv in an area for a few months, do you lose popularity? I haven't seen it happen.</p></div></blockquote><p> </p><p> 1st: Kindof. Basically if the broadcaster your using is a higher popularity then whatever popularity you have in that region, it'll be harder to put on good shows. Higher popularity broadcasters will expect big names to headline cards, so if you don't have one for that region, it can be detrimental as, while yes more people will be watching your show, it'll be harder to please the audience and, thus, the broadcaster. Best course of action is to just stick with broadcasters in your popularity range, then as you get bigger, sign new deals with bigger networks.</p><p> </p><p> 2. No, not a feature that was brought over. You could run one show a year if you wanted to with no penalties.</p>
